Fede Valverde publicly responds to the incident with Tchouaméni
The Real Madrid is going through a delicate period within its locker room after a violent altercation that occurred during training on Thursday, May 7, 2026, between Fede Valverde and Aurélien Tchouaméni. The confrontation was particularly serious, with Valverde suffering a cranio-cerebral trauma that required hospitalization and will result in an absence of 10 to 14 days. Both players are also facing a disciplinary case opened by the club.
Faced with rising rumors and media attention, the Uruguayan midfielder decided to break the silence via a post on his social networks. This message comes in a context of palpable tension that could have repercussions on the dynamics of the Madrid group.
